Why You Should Have More Than One SAAB Replacement Key

Have an extra key on hand to save time and hassle. It's especially important when your key fob suddenly ceases to function. The most common cause is a dead coin battery however, it could be other things as well.

It can cost about PS1500 to add a new car key at a dealer, and the work can take up to 10 days.

Most used Saabs come with only one key. A second key requires the use of a special computer (often known as the CIM) in addition to an entirely new key and programming in order to convince the vehicle that you're not trying to steal the vehicle. The majority of locksmiths won't do this because it's too expensive. You can do it yourself, provided you're fortunate enough to find the right components at a reasonable cost.
